专业接各种小工具软件及爬虫软件开发,联系Q:2391047879

PyInstaller打包的Excel处理小程序

发布时间: 2025-08-16 15:30:03 浏览量: 本文共包含627个文字,预计阅读时间2分钟

日常办公场景中,Excel文件的高频处理常伴随重复性操作,例如数据清洗、格式转换、多表合并等。传统手动操作效率低且易出错,而市面通用软件又难以匹配个性化需求。针对这一痛点,一款基于Python开发、通过PyInstaller封装为独立可执行文件的Excel处理工具应运而生,为中小型企业及个人用户提供轻量化解决方案。

核心功能与技术实现

该工具采用Pandas库作为数据处理引擎,能够快速完成百万级数据行的批量操作。其特色功能包括:

  • 智能识别CSV/XLS/XLSX格式混合文件
  • 自定义公式校验与异常数据自动标注
  • 多工作簿数据透视表联动生成
  • 敏感信息模糊化处理模块
  • 借助PyInstaller的跨平台打包能力,开发者将Python脚本与依赖库封装为Windows/MacOS双平台兼容的独立程序。这种处理方式有效规避了用户端Python环境配置难题,即便是非技术人员也可通过双击.exe或.app文件直接运行程序。打包过程中特别加入资源压缩技术,最终生成文件体积控制在30MB以内,优于同类工具的平均水平。

    典型应用场景剖析

    某电商企业的周报生成流程验证了工具的实用性。原先需要3名运营人员耗时4小时完成的订单数据汇总,通过该工具实现:

    1. 自动抓取6个渠道的差异格式报表

    2. 标准化商品编号与SKU对照

    3. 生成带数据校验公式的汇总模板

    整体流程压缩至15分钟完成,准确率由人工操作的92%提升至100%。类似的效率提升在财务报表合并、科研数据处理等场景中均有显著体现。

    安全与兼容性考量

    程序采用内存计算模式,原始文件不会产生临时缓存。对于含宏指令的Excel文件,工具会主动禁用执行权限并以只读模式处理。在Windows 7及以上系统、MacOS 10.15+环境中测试显示,程序运行稳定性达到98.6%。开发者每季度更新版本库,及时适配WPS最新格式与Office 365的API变更。

    程序界面保留命令行参数入口,支持进阶用户通过bat/sh脚本实现定时任务。工具包内附带的配置文件允许自定义日志存储路径与错误重试机制,兼顾了小白用户与专业用户的双重需求。

    跨平台部署能力|无环境依赖设计|毫秒级响应速度|可视化操作界面——这四个维度构成了该工具区别于传统解决方案的差异化竞争力。